CSM Râmnicu Sărat

Clubul Sportiv Municipal Râmnicu Sărat (Romanian pronunciation: [ˌklubul sporˈtiv ˈrɨmniku ˌrɨmniku səˈrat]), commonly known as CSM Râmnicu Sărat or Râmnicu Sărat, is a Romanian professional football club from Râmnicu Sărat, Buzău County, Romania, founded in 1966.
